Job Description - Ophthalmology Veterinary Assistant

Veterinary Assistant – Ophthalmology Department


Eastern Pennsylvania Veterinary Medical Center (EPVMC)


EPVMC was founded on the belief that pets of the Lehigh Valley deserve access to advanced veterinary care 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. What started as a commitment to emergency medicine has grown into a collaborative specialty hospital where doctors, technicians, assistants, and client care teams work together to support patients with complex medical needs.


As we continue to grow, our Ophthalmology Department is expanding. We are looking for a Veterinary Technician Assistant who thrives in a fast-paced, highly specialized environment and enjoys working closely with patients, clients, and a dedicated specialty team. This position is ideal for someone who is eager to learn, enjoys hands-on patient care, and takes pride in supporting advanced veterinary medicine.


What You'll Do



  • Assist with patient restraint and handling during ophthalmic examinations and procedures

  • Prepare examination rooms, equipment, and supplies for appointments and procedures

  • Obtain patient histories and assist with patient intake

  • Support diagnostics and treatments under the direction of the veterinarian and technical staff

  • Assist with patient admissions, discharges, and client communication

  • • Maintain cleanliness and organization of the department

  • Stock supplies and assist with inventory management

  • Support anesthesia and recovery processes as directed

  • Help ensure a positive experience for both patients and their families


What We’re Looking For



  • 1-2 Year of general practice experience or equivalent role

  • Ability to remain calm and focused in high-acuity situations

  • Strong teamwork and communication skills

  • Willingness to learn and grow in a highly specialized department
